I can see why someone like John Flynn would like a system like this -- cutting out all those die-cut pieces for his kits -- or even a quilt guild which plans a big project, but I still don't understand why an ordinary quilter would want one except for a one-block quilt.
Maybe I don't understand how this thing works, but from what I have seen, I don't get it.
1. Isn't there an awful lot of wasted fabric created when you use these dies?
2. An ordinary quilt takes lots and lots of different size pieces. Wouldn't it cost a fortune to collect even enough dies to make a single quilt?
What am I not understanding?

I have had an Accuquilt since last July when I won one! At that time there wasn't the " Go" size so I won the large cutter. Honestly I would never have been able to buy this since I don't make enough quilts to justify the cost. I won the machine but NO dies and they are costly. I figured I won it for a reason so I better get some dies so I could use it. There are some sets with several shapes (squares, rectangle, triangle etc) that combine to make many blocks of a certain size. I got the 12" set and two other separate dies. You can cut strips and fanfold them or little chunks of fabric to just cover the shape you are cutting so as not to waste lots of fabric. I made a quilt out of men's dress shirts and cut most of it on the Accuquilt. It works well with scraps too. The winding way table runner in my profile was all cut with the dies and went together VERY easily. I would RECOMMEND it especially if several people went together and jointly bought and used it or if you really make a lot of quilts. So there is my opinion after a year of use. I have the Go cutter and it's great. I don't understand why many would think the cutter is for one block quilts. I cut squares, HST, hexagons, strips, triangles, circles and some shapes. I have very little fabric waste. The tumbler die is worth the cost of the machine to me. I love having the time savings plus no hurting hands from rotary cutting. Sure it cost more than a rotary cutter and a ruler but when those came available I heard the same thing, why would any one want that when they can cut with scissors?Lyndhurst, Ohio USA - East Side Suburb of Cleveland, Ohio
